    WHAT TO EXPECTTo be part of the Climate Control Core Team to support the programme delivery teams to roll out new and enhanced Under bonnet Climate Control Components across the various vehicle build programmes.

    Subject Matter Experts (SME) are the key fact holders within the JLR business for a commodity or group of commodities.

    They are responsible for applying learning, developing the future direction of their commodities, maintaining good alignment to JLR business behaviours and striving to provide a high-quality service to customers.

    For this role the SME will be creating and maintaining design standards, design rules and requirements for the Under-bonnet Climate Control Group.
